Clutch Problem 2008 MT

I think I have a problem with my clutch. It is difficult to shift between gears. When the engine is not running the gears shift smoothly. When I start the engine it is very difficult to shift into gear. When traveling I can shift but it is difficult, the gears do not slide in easily. They do not grind but it is difficult to engage. This seemed to start happening after some hard driving. Any thoughts. It kind of feels like the clutch is not completely disengaging.

2008 Fit Sport MT, 85K miles. Love the car, this is the first trouble.
